How do you make a wireless bridge?

A wireless bridge connects two wired networks together over Wi-Fi. The wireless bridge acts as a client, logging in to the primary router and getting an Internet connection, which it passes on to the devices connected to its LAN Jacks.

How do you connect to a wireless bridge?

Here’s how to do it.

  1. Position the bridge. Place the wireless bridge within range of your wireless router’s signal, and also within a cable’s length of your wired devices.
  2. Connect the bridge to your network. If your router supports Wi-Fi Protected Setup, or WPS, setup is easy.
  3. Plug in network devices.

What does a wireless bridge?

A wireless bridge is a solution (specifically, a set of devices) that allows you to connect two networks, or more accurately two network segments, over a wireless channel – sort of like a bridge, if you will, hence the name. This way, two IP networks can be connected through a wireless link.

What is a bridge between two networks?

A network bridge is a computer networking device that creates a single, aggregate network from multiple communication networks or network segments. Routing allows multiple networks to communicate independently and yet remain separate, whereas bridging connects two separate networks as if they were a single network.
